Working principle

The display design can use either front or rear projection, in which one or more video projectors are directed at the glass plate. Each projector's beam widens as it approaches the surface and then is bundled again by the lenses' arrangement on the glass. This forms a virtual point of origin, so that the image source appears to be an imaginary object somewhere close to the glass. In rear projection (the common use case), the light passes through the glass; in front projection it is reflected.
